What are some common challenges faced by freelance ASP.NET Core developers when working with clients remotely?

Freelance ASP.NET Core developers often encounter challenges such as clearly defining project requirements with clients who may not have technical backgrounds, managing communication across different time zones, and ensuring secure access to development environments. Additionally, freelancers must proactively set expectations regarding deliverables, timelines, and feedback cycles to avoid misunderstandings. Building trust and maintaining transparency through regular updates and documentation can help mitigate these challenges and foster successful long-term collaborations.

What is a freelance ASP.NET Core developer?

Freelance ASP.NET Core developers are independent professionals who specialize in building, maintaining, and optimizing web applications using the ASP.NET Core framework. They work on a contract or project basis for various clients, rather than being employed full-time by a single company. These developers are skilled in C#, .NET Core, and related technologies, and often help businesses with tasks such as web API development, backend services, and cloud integration. Freelance ASP.NET Core developers typically manage their own schedules, scope of work, and client relationships.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a freelance ASP.NET Core developer?

To thrive as a Freelance ASP.NET Core Developer, you need deep knowledge of C#, ASP.NET Core framework, web development principles, and a solid portfolio demonstrating real-world projects. Familiarity with tools like Visual Studio, Git, SQL Server, and experience with REST APIs, as well as certifications such as Microsoft Certified: Azure Developer Associate, are highly beneficial. Strong communication, time management, and problem-solving skills help you manage client relationships and deliver projects independently. These skills and qualifications ensure you can build robust web applications, meet client requirements, and maintain a steady stream of freelance work.
